9+ Words Rhyming With Too: A Quick Guide

Perfect rhymes share the same vowel and consonant sounds following the initial consonant or consonant cluster. For instance, “blue,” “shoe,” and “new” all share the same vowel and concluding sounds as the word in question. Near rhymes, also known as slant or half rhymes, share some, but not all, of these sounds. Examples include “true” or “tattoo,” where the vowel sound is similar but not identical. Eye rhymes, like “through,” look as if they should rhyme based on spelling, but their pronunciations differ.

Understanding these nuances enhances language skills, particularly in creative writing and poetry. Precise rhyming creates musicality and emphasizes themes, while near rhymes can add subtle complexity.
